Congrats on being in the home stretch!!!

If you are still following Phase 1, you DEFINITELY want to add a packet 1/2 hour after exercise, no matter what you decide to do. We are taking in so few calories you need to give your body the extra fuel for muscle recovery.

I am about 18lbs to goal and I'm going to start incorporating gentle yoga into my routine, mostly for core strength and flexibility. I wasn't much of an exerciser just before IP, so I'm taking it slow till I'm closer to goal. If you feel you're ready, go for it but LISTEN TO YOUR BODY! Too much fatigue, dizziness, muscle weakness may mean you pushed yourself too quickly, or didn't fuel your body enough. Our bodies tell us a LOT when we pay attention

Hi Fitgirl,
If your calorie count for your P3 breakfast was around 400 calories give or take, then you are fine. just watch the carb sources so that you follow the protocol and you're all good. your P3 day looks like my day, and my coach said I could have any IP snack, including restricteds. I believe LizzRR put the calorie guidelines for P2 and P3 up, but I dont remember the thread name. But I do remember that p2 is roughly 1100 calories a day, and P3 is around 1400 cals a day. each phase adds 300 calories from the 800 cal guideline for P1. WHen you get to maintenance, your calorie/nutrition should be based on your individual needs, and not according to the protocol sheet.
